2008 Kia Opirus vs. 2012 Mazda CX-7

To start off, 2012 Mazda CX-7 is newer by 4 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2008 Kia Opirus.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2008 Kia Opirus would be higher. At 3,497 cc (6 cylinders), 2008 Kia Opirus is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2012 Mazda CX-7 (244 HP @ 5000 RPM) has 44 more horse power than 2008 Kia Opirus. (200 HP @ 5500 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2012 Mazda CX-7 should accelerate faster than 2008 Kia Opirus.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2008 Kia Opirus weights approximately 179 kg more than 2012 Mazda CX-7.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2012 Mazda CX-7 (349 Nm @ 2500 RPM) has 51 more torque (in Nm) than 2008 Kia Opirus. (298 Nm @ 3500 RPM). This means 2012 Mazda CX-7 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2008 Kia Opirus.
